1. A battery-state monitoring system which monitors a state of each of a plurality of storage batteries connected in series and constituting an assembled battery incorporated in an equipment, the system comprising:

  • a current detecting device which detects a current in each of the storage batteries; and

    a state measuring device which measures a temperature, a voltage, and internal resistance of each of the storage batteries, the internal resistance being measured by using at least two or more kinds of frequencies including at least a first frequency of lower than 200 Hz and a second frequency of 200 Hz or higher to lower than 2000 Hz,wherein degradation of each of the storage batteries is estimated based on at least one or more values of the temperature, the voltage, and the internal resistance measured by the state measuring device and a DC resistance of each of the storage batteries obtained from a ratio between a change in a current value detected by the current detecting device and a change in a voltage value measured by the state measuring device during discharging of each of the storage batteries;

    wherein the state measuring device measures and records a temperature and a voltage regularly at a given time interval, and when a state where a voltage drop from a normal voltage value by a given threshold or more has continued for a given time is detected, the state measuring device protects measurement data of the voltage obtained in a given time range before and after a point of time of the detection so as not to be lost.
